Sri Chinmoy
Quotes

An Indian spiritual teacher who emphasized the unity of all religions and the importance of inner peace through meditation. His teachings encouraged self-transcendence and devotion, guiding individuals to connect with their higher selves and the divine. A prolific author, poet, and musician, he was known for his deep compassion and for inspiring others to embrace love, joy, and the pursuit of spiritual realization in their everyday lives.
